Refreshing Fruit-Based Drinks
Fruit-based non-alcoholic drinks are among the most popular and versatile options. They combine natural sweetness with vibrant colors, making them appealing and refreshing.
Berry Lemonade
A simple yet flavorful drink, berry lemonade combines the tartness of lemons with the sweetness of fresh berries
- Muddle a mix of strawberries, blueberries, and raspberries.
- Add fresh lemon juice, a touch of honey or agave, and cold water.
- Serve over ice with a garnish of mint leaves for a refreshing summer beverage.
Mango Lassi
Originating from India, mango lassi is a creamy, sweet drink that combines ripe mangoes with yogurt
- Blend mango puree with yogurt, milk, and a little sugar or honey.
- Add a pinch of cardamom for an aromatic touch.
- Serve chilled, often topped with crushed pistachios for added texture.
Cucumber Melon Cooler
This drink is light and hydrating, perfect for hot days
- Blend fresh cucumber and honeydew melon with lime juice.
- Strain if desired and serve over ice.
- Garnish with cucumber slices or melon balls for a decorative touch.
Herbal and Botanical Drinks
Herbal and botanical beverages are unique because they highlight natural flavors from plants, flowers, and herbs. They are often caffeine-free and packed with antioxidants.
Lavender Lemonade
This aromatic drink uses edible lavender for a fragrant twist on traditional lemonade
- Infuse water with dried lavender buds for 5-10 minutes.
- Mix lavender-infused water with fresh lemon juice and sweetener.
- Serve chilled with lemon slices and a sprig of lavender.
Hibiscus Iced Tea
Hibiscus tea offers a tart, cranberry-like flavor and a deep red color
- Steep dried hibiscus petals in hot water, then chill.
- Add a natural sweetener like honey or agave to balance the tartness.
- Serve over ice with fresh mint or citrus wedges.
Rosemary Citrus Sparkler
This sophisticated beverage combines herbal notes with sparkling water
- Muddle fresh rosemary sprigs with lemon or orange slices.
- Add sparkling water and a touch of honey or maple syrup.
- Serve in a tall glass with a rosemary sprig garnish for visual appeal.
Creative Mocktails
Mocktails are non-alcoholic cocktails that mimic the style and sophistication of alcoholic drinks, often using fresh ingredients and creative presentation.
Virgin Mojito
A refreshing classic that uses lime, mint, and sparkling water
- Muddle fresh mint leaves and lime wedges.
- Add sugar or simple syrup, then top with sparkling water.
- Serve over ice and garnish with a mint sprig for a crisp, cool drink.
Pineapple Ginger Fizz
This tropical mocktail is spicy, sweet, and fizzy
- Combine pineapple juice with freshly grated ginger.
- Add a splash of club soda for fizz.
- Garnish with a pineapple wedge or thin ginger slice.
Apple Cinnamon Cooler
This drink brings warmth and flavor, perfect for autumn
- Mix fresh apple juice with a cinnamon stick or ground cinnamon.
- Add sparkling water for a refreshing twist.
- Serve chilled with a cinnamon stick garnish.
Vegetable-Based Non-Alcoholic Drinks
Vegetable-based drinks provide unique flavors and health benefits. They are often combined with fruits to enhance taste and presentation.
Carrot Ginger Juice
This juice is both vibrant and invigorating
- Juice fresh carrots with a small piece of ginger.
- Add a squeeze of lemon juice for acidity.
- Serve over ice and optionally garnish with a carrot stick or lemon slice.
Beetroot Lemonade
Beets provide natural sweetness and a striking color
- Juice fresh beets and mix with lemon juice and honey.
- Add water or sparkling water for a refreshing drink.
- Serve chilled with lemon or beet slices for decoration.
Tomato Basil Refresher
This savory drink offers a sophisticated, vegetable-forward flavor
- Blend fresh tomatoes with basil leaves and a touch of salt.
- Add a splash of lemon juice or vinegar for acidity.
- Serve over ice and garnish with a basil leaf.
Tips for Creating Unique Non-Alcoholic Drinks
Making unique drinks at home can be easy with a few helpful tips
- Experiment with combinations of fruits, vegetables, herbs, and spices for creative flavors.
- Use natural sweeteners like honey, agave, or maple syrup instead of refined sugar.
- Incorporate sparkling water, tonic, or coconut water for effervescence and variety.
- Garnish with fresh herbs, citrus slices, or edible flowers for visual appeal.
- Adjust acidity and sweetness to balance flavors according to personal taste.
